ARE THERE PAYMENT PLANS?

When booking you can choose from one of the following payment options:

  • Pay in full: you will pay the full fee on checkout
  • Deposit with single payment: you only pay the deposit on checkout and pay all remaining fees in a single payment up to one month before the week of camp begins.
  • Deposit with 5 payments: you only pay the deposit on checkout and pay the remaining fees in 5 equal monthly instalments – if there are less than 5 months between booking and the week of camp then the number of instalments will be reduced accordingly.

Please note all fees must be paid in full one month before the week of camp commences.

How do I know my child will be well looked after?

  • Our experienced team of volunteers have all had safeguarding training and follow strict guidelines in making sure your child is well cared for. We also DBS check each and every member of the team at camp from leaders to site officers.
  • Each week we have experienced first aiders available to deal with medical issues that may arise or the camper has come with.
  • The cookhouse team also have to undergo rigorous hygiene training before being allowed to work in the kitchen. Check out our food hygiene rating.
